Mumbai: Bids floated for Bhayander-Ghodbunder Road plan

This 6.92 km road will snake through Jesal Park-St. Tukaram Road-Indralok, Navghar to eventually emerge at the junction of National Highway-8 and Ghodbunder Road.

With an exponential increase in the population of Mira Road-Bhayander, there has also been a need to provide more and better connectivity within as well as to the highway. This is where the need to have Bhayander-Ghodbunder Road connectivity has arisen.

The proposed road, that is in the initial stages of planning, will be built as well as widened on certain stretches between Jesal Park in Bhayander and the junction of Mumbai-Ahmedabad Highway-Ghodbunder Road. The segment of last 2 km on the Ghodbunder Road end will be widened, while the rest will have to be constructed afresh, elevated.

"Bids have been floated to appoint consultant for conducting feasibility study, soil investigations, preparing Detailed Project Report, estimates, etc," said M. S. Narkar, executive engineer of MMRDA.

This 6.92 km road will snake through Jesal Park-St. Tukaram Road-Indralok, Navghar to eventually emerge at the junction of National Highway-8 and Ghodbunder Road.

Out of the entire stretch, only 3.12 km does not fall under the Coastal Regulatory Zone, whereas, the balance segment will need the nod of Maharashtra Coastal Zone Management Authority (MCZMA) as well as Ministry of Environment and Forest (MoEF) before the project takes off.

Although the initial estimates prepared, suggests that the project will require Rs80 crore as expenditure, but as the years progress, the final estimates will be much more as there's a likelihood of suggestion of this road being constructed on stilts to avoid destruction of mangroves between Jesal Park and Navghar.

As the project is in nascent stages of planning, authorities are yet to fix a deadline for it or even the timeline for implementation via tendering. The consultancy firm is expected to submit their report by the end of this year.

PROJECT: Bhayander-Ghodbunder Road
LENGTH: 6.92 kms
ESTIMATED COST: Rs 80 kms
LANES: 2+2 Lanes
